在数字时代,虚拟机已成为许多人实现多系统并行、测试软件或体验不同平台的重要工具,不少用户在虚拟机中运行游戏时,常遭遇“游戏很卡”的困境,这不仅影响游戏体验,甚至可能导致虚拟机形同虚设,要解决这一问题,需从虚拟机配置、宿主机性能、系统优化及游戏设置等多维度入手,层层排查,方能找到症结所在。

虚拟机配置:硬件资源的合理分配是基础
虚拟机的性能表现,首先取决于其硬件资源分配是否合理,作为虚拟化的核心,CPU、内存、显存及硬盘资源直接决定了游戏运行的流畅度。
CPU资源分配不足是导致卡顿的首要原因,虚拟机通过虚拟化技术调用宿主机的CPU核心,若分配给虚拟机的核心数量过少,或CPU超线程未开启,当游戏需要大量计算时,虚拟机处理器便会不堪重负,出现帧率骤降、操作延迟等问题,建议根据宿主机CPU的核心数,为虚拟机分配50%-70%的CPU资源(如宿主机为8核,可分配4-5核),并确保在虚拟机设置中启用“虚拟化技术”(如Intel VT-x或AMD-V),这是虚拟机高效运行的前提。
内存大小同样关键,游戏运行需占用大量内存,若虚拟机内存分配不足,系统会频繁调用虚拟内存(硬盘空间),导致数据读写速度急剧下降,引发严重卡顿,一般而言,运行大型游戏时,虚拟机内存至少需分配8GB,若宿主机内存充裕(16GB以上),可考虑分配16GB或更多,同时关闭宿主机及其他不必要的后台程序,避免内存资源争抢。
显存与显卡虚拟化是游戏性能的“命脉”,许多用户在配置虚拟机时,仅使用默认的虚拟显卡(如VMware的SVGA或VirtualBox的VBoxSVGA),这类显卡性能孱弱,无法满足游戏对图形处理的需求,需启用3D加速功能,并分配独立的显存(建议至少256MB,大型游戏可分配512MB以上),部分虚拟机软件(如VMware Workstation Pro)支持“直通显卡”(GPU Passthrough),可将宿主机的物理显卡直接分配给虚拟机,大幅提升图形性能,但此功能需宿主机支持VT-d或AMD-Vi技术,且配置过程较为复杂。
硬盘性能也不容忽视,虚拟机硬盘文件(如.vmdk或.vdi)若存储在传统机械硬盘(HDD)上,其随机读写速度远低于固态硬盘(SSD),会导致游戏加载缓慢、地图切换卡顿,最佳方案是将虚拟机硬盘文件存放在NVMe或SATA SSD上,并确保虚拟机磁盘控制器类型选择为“NVMe”或“LSI Logic SAS”(而非默认的IDE),以充分发挥SSD的读写性能。
宿主机环境:性能瓶颈的隐形推手
虚拟机并非独立于宿主机存在,其性能上限受宿主机硬件及系统状态直接影响,若宿主机本身性能不足或资源被占用过多,虚拟机游戏卡顿在所难免。
宿主机硬件性能是虚拟机性能的“天花板”,若宿主机CPU老旧、内存不足或显卡性能孱弱,即使为虚拟机分配了较高资源,也难以流畅运行游戏,使用入门级i3处理器搭配8GB内存的宿主机,即使为虚拟机分配4核CPU和6GB内存,运行大型游戏时仍会捉襟见肘,在搭建虚拟机游戏环境前,需评估宿主机硬件是否满足需求:建议宿主机至少为i5/R5级别以上,内存16GB起步,显卡建议中端游戏显卡(如GTX 1660/RX 580以上)。

后台程序资源占用是常见“隐形杀手”,宿主机若运行了大量后台程序(如杀毒软件、下载工具、视频剪辑软件等),会持续占用CPU、内存及磁盘I/O资源,导致虚拟机可用资源不足,需通过任务管理器(Windows)或活动监视器(macOS)查看资源占用情况,关闭不必要的程序,为虚拟机腾出“呼吸空间”,若宿主机开启了Windows的“超级预加载”(Superfetch)或“快速启动”功能,也可能导致磁盘I/O争抢,建议临时关闭。
虚拟机软件本身的性能损耗也不可忽视,不同的虚拟机软件(VMware、VirtualBox、Hyper-V等)对硬件的虚拟化效率存在差异,VMware Workstation Pro在性能优化和3D加速支持上更为成熟,适合游戏场景;VirtualBox作为免费软件,功能齐全但性能略逊;Hyper-V作为Windows系统内置虚拟化工具,性能较好但配置复杂且对宿主机系统版本有要求,根据需求选择合适的虚拟机软件,并及时更新至最新版本,可借助官方优化提升性能。
系统与游戏优化:释放虚拟机的“内在潜力”
在完成硬件配置与宿主机优化后,还需对虚拟机系统及游戏本身进行针对性优化,进一步挖掘性能潜力。
虚拟机系统精简是提升效率的关键,安装虚拟机操作系统时,应避免预装过多不必要的软件和服务,以Windows为例,可禁用“家庭组”“Windows搜索”等非必要服务,关闭“视觉效果”(如“调整为最佳性能”),并通过“任务管理器”启动项管理,禁止后台程序自启,确保虚拟机系统驱动程序已更新至最新版本,尤其是显卡驱动、芯片组驱动及存储驱动,以兼容最新的虚拟化技术。
游戏设置与优化需“因地制宜”,虚拟机中的游戏无法像在物理机上那样追求极致画质,应根据虚拟机性能合理调整游戏设置:降低分辨率(如从1080P降至720P)、关闭或降低“阴影”“抗锯齿”“纹理质量”等高负荷选项,开启“垂直同步”以减少帧率波动,部分游戏还支持“虚拟机模式”优化(如《原神》的“兼容模式”),可尝试开启,确保游戏安装在虚拟机SSD上,而非通过文件夹共享访问宿主机硬盘,避免因网络延迟导致卡顿。
网络与输入延迟优化同样重要,虚拟机网络模式(如NAT、桥接)会影响游戏的网络延迟,若游戏对实时性要求较高(如FPS、MOBA类),建议使用“桥接模式”使虚拟机获得独立IP,减少网络转换开销,输入延迟方面,确保虚拟机安装了增强型键盘鼠标驱动(如VMware Tools或VirtualBox Guest Additions),可提升输入响应速度,部分虚拟机软件还支持“USB直连”功能,可将游戏手柄直接接入虚拟机,减少输入延迟。
进阶技巧与替代方案:突破虚拟机的性能边界
若常规优化仍无法解决卡顿问题,可尝试进阶技巧,或考虑替代方案。

GPU直通技术是终极优化方案,通过VMware ESXi、Proxmox VE等专业虚拟化平台,可实现宿主机物理显卡的完全直通,使虚拟机独占显卡资源,性能接近物理机,但此技术需主板支持VT-d/AMD-Vi,且需修改BIOS设置,配置门槛较高,适合有一定技术基础的用户。
云游戏平台可作为替代选择,对于无法在虚拟机中流畅运行的大型游戏,可尝试NVIDIA GeForce Now、Xbox Cloud Gaming等云游戏平台,通过云端服务器运行游戏,仅将画面流传输至本地设备,可绕过虚拟机性能瓶颈,但需稳定的网络环境(建议50Mbps以上带宽)且可能产生延迟。
轻量级虚拟机系统适合轻度游戏需求,若仅需运行一些对性能要求不高的游戏(如网页游戏、 indie游戏),可考虑使用轻量级虚拟机系统(如Linux发行版Lubuntu、Xfce版Ubuntu),其资源占用远低于Windows系统,可在有限的硬件资源下提升流畅度。
虚拟机游戏卡顿是一个系统性问题,需从硬件配置、宿主机环境、系统优化到游戏设置全方位排查,合理分配虚拟机资源、优化宿主机性能、精简系统与游戏设置,是解决卡顿的核心步骤,对于追求极致体验的用户,GPU直通或云游戏平台则是值得尝试的进阶方案,虚拟机虽在性能上无法完全媲美物理机,但通过科学配置与优化,仍能在特定场景下实现“以软代硬”的价值,为用户带来便捷的多平台体验。



















